TOUR: Texas musicians Leon Bridges and Charley Crockett are joining forces for their co-headlining tour 2025 that promises to bring a unique blend of soul, R&B, and Americana to fans across North America.
The tour, titled “The Crooner & The Cowboy,” will span 21 cities, kicking off on August 26 in Milwaukee and concluding on September 23 in Austin. Other notable stops on the tour will include Toronto, Philadelphia, Richmond, Cincinnati Raleigh, Charlton, St. Augustin, and Oklahoma City. Special guests Noeline Hofmann, Reyna Tropical, and Dave Alvin & Jimmie Dale Gilmore will support the joint trek on select dates.

ABOUT: Leon Bridges first gained national attention with his debut single “Coming Home” in 2014, which quickly drew comparisons to classic soul artists like Sam Cooke and Otis Redding. The song’s success led to a deal with Columbia Records, and in 2015, he released his debut album, “Coming Home.” The album received critical acclaim and earned a Grammy nomination for Best R&B Album.
His follow-up album, “Good Thing” (2018), marked a shift toward a more contemporary R&B and pop sound while retaining his soulful roots. The album included hits like “Beyond” and won the Grammy Award for Best Traditional R&B Performance for the song “Bet Ain’t Worth the Hand.”
In 2021, Bridges released his third studio album, “Gold-Diggers Sound,” which showcased his growth as an artist and received another Grammy nomination. The album was praised for its intimate songwriting and genre-blending production.
Throughout his career, Leon Bridges has collaborated with artists such as John Mayer, Khruangbin, and Kacey Musgraves. His work is celebrated for bridging the gap between vintage soul and modern music, earning him a place among the most respected contemporary soul artists. Bridges continues to tour and release new music, evolving his sound while honoring the rich traditions of American soul and R&B.
